Newcastle Preview: In The Congo Ready To Strike
November 11, 2022

IN-FORM jockey Tim Clark believes the 2021winner of the Golden Rose Stakes In The Congo is ready to return to the winner’s list for the first time since that victory in the $2.5 million The Hunter.
In The Congo was ridden by Clark in the Golden Eagle and they had little peace in the lead and he tired to finish seventh in the 1500 metres event.
“My horse is the one to beat and I believe he is as good as Gai and Adrian could have him. I worked In The Congo the other day and his work was outstanding,” Clark told Racing NSW during the week.

“He is a fast horse, but so are Apache Chase and Overpass. I have a lovely draw and if he is headed during the race, the leaders are going too fast it won’t help their chances. I can take a sit if we are headed, the 1300m suits In The Congo and he has a good cruising speed,” Clark said. View Bet365 Odds
In The Congo is one of three Group 1 winners in the race and the others are the 2022 Kingsford-Smith Stakes winner the Queenslander Apache Chase and also the 2021 Randwick Guineas winner in Lion’s Roar.
Apache Chase’s trainer Desleigh Forster said she had targeted this race and she had been happy with his two runs this time in in Sydney.
